Temperature-dependent development and survival of Hypera nigrirostris

This research investigates how temperature affects development, survival, and phenology across all life stages of the lesser clover leaf weevil.

I conduct controlled environment experiments across temperatures from 5°C to 30°C to quantify:

  • instar-specific development times
  • pupation and emergence rates
  • survival curves at thermal extremes
  • developmental thresholds (lower/upper)

These data support pest forecasting models, improving the timing of monitoring and management practices.
